Shifting Priorities: The Future of Apple’s AI and Robotics
Recent developments within Apple suggest a strategic pivot, notably in its handling of AI projects like Siri and its foray into robotics. The departure of key initiatives from John Giannandrea, Apple’s AI Chief, and their reallocation within the organization reflects broader trends and potential future advancements in AI and robotics.
Redefining AI Strategies
The reorganization of Apple’s AI efforts, highlighted by the transfer of control for projects such as Siri, indicates a reassessment of strategy. The challenges in delivering promised AI functionalities have likely prompted this shift, mirroring moves seen across the tech industry as companies streamline their operations to prioritize innovation and efficiency.
Giannandrea, known for his cautious approach towards generative AI and strong emphasis on data privacy, might find his more conservative methodologies at odds with the fast-paced advancements in AI driven by competitors like OpenAI and Google.
Embracing Robotics: A New Chapter for Apple
The transfer of Apple’s secretive robotics project from Giannandrea’s oversight to John Ternus marks a significant development. With Ternus at the helm, the project is anticipated to gain momentum. Ternus’s leadership in hardware and his successful track record with the Vision Pro project could imbue the robotics initiative with renewed vitality.
Expect innovative home devices, possibly taking cues from ongoing research efforts in robotics that Apple has already demonstrated through prototypes like the lamp-robot “Luxo Jr.” These devices could revolutionize the smart home landscape, integrating seamlessly with the larger Apple ecosystem.
